The University of Prince Edward Island’s four-year doctor of psychology (PsyD) in clinical psychology program has been granted accreditation for a three-year term by the Canadian Psychological Association (CPA).

On Thursday, May 11, six student teams pitched their business concepts for a share of $50,000 in prize money from the Harry W. MacLauchlan Entrepreneurship Program during the UPEI Panther Pitch Competition. The competition for entrepreneurial undergraduate students is coordinated each year by UPEI’s Experiential Education Department.

Reilly Sullivan, a fourth-year biology student and varsity athlete at the University of Prince Edward Island, has been awarded a 2023 3M National Student Fellowship by the Society for Teaching and Learning in Higher Education (STLHE).
